Description
For many novice players their amp is the boring, functional part of their first set-up. This guide explains how it can be as exciting, inspirational and as important as their guitar. Viewing the amp as an instrument in its own right, this book defines both the fundamental and subtle differences between many types of amplifier, while offering valuable info on tone-tweaking every kind to suit different styles. Learn how to adjust your amp for a whole range of different tones and how to use its functions to maximum effect. The text also explains how to choose the right products within your price-range and requirements, and how to maintain amplifier equipment for safe and reliable use. By taking an objective and comprehensive view of available guitar amps, this book offers the best bang-for-buck advice to getting killer tones easily, affordably and blasting at the right level.
